Approach each situation using the following precautions:
•
Understand the problem.
•
Check the symptoms to determine probable cause.
•
Take appropriate action to fix the problem.
Once the repairs are completed, test to see if the equipment is functioning normally.
If not, look for other probable causes and take corrective action until the system is
returned to service.
Safety Precautions
Nothing is more important than safety. The simple rule of safety is that if you think
safety is for the other person; let the job be, too. Keep in mind that beside yourself,
you are also responsible for the safety of everyone around you.
•
Information provided in this guide is intended for use by qualified technicians.
Attempting repairs without the proper training, tools and equipment can result in
personal injury and/or property damage.
•
Some of the procedures described in this guide require the use of specialized
tools or equipment. Make sure the proper tools or equipment are available
before attempting repairs.
•
Be aware of the work environment (rotating equipment and hazardous exhaust
fumes etc). Be sure protective shields are in place and the work area is properly
ventilated.
•
Wear eye and ear protection when needed. Wear protective shoes as required
by job conditions.
•
Be aware of high voltages and take adequate precautions to avoid getting
shocked.
•
When you need to replace parts, use only the recommended replacement parts.
Do not use parts of inferior quality.
•
Observe all cautionary notices to reduce or avoid the risk of personal injury or
equipment damage.
•
Work carefully around machinery that is in operation.
Solenoid Troubleshooting Process
Solenoid troubleshooting can be approached in a couple of ways:
1. You can decide to remove the solenoid from the installation and bench test it
first. After making sure the solenoid is working, you can re-install the solenoid
and test it on the application.
OR
2. You can test the solenoid while still installed on the application and remove it for
bench testing only after eliminating other possible sources of trouble.
